The 1989 European Curling Championships were held from December 5 to 9 at the Sportzentrum Erlen arena in Engelberg, Switzerland.[1][2]

The Scottish men's team won their fifth title and the West German women's team won their fourth title.[3]

The event was televised on Eurosport.[4]

Final standings

The final rankings were as follows.[1]

Place Country Skip Games Wins Losses
Шаблон:Gold1 Шаблон:SCO Hammy McMillan 6 6 0
Шаблон:Silver2 Шаблон:NOR Eigil Ramsfjell 7 5 2
Шаблон:Bronze3 Шаблон:FRG Keith Wendorf 9 6 3
4 Шаблон:FRA Dominique Dupont-Roc 10 5 5
5 Шаблон:SWE Per Lindeman 8 5 3
6 Шаблон:SUI Markus Känzig 7 4 3
7 Шаблон:AUT Alois Kreidl 7 3 4
8 Шаблон:WAL Adrian Meikle 7 2 5
9 Шаблон:ITA Andrea Pavani 7 4 3
10 Шаблон:DEN Frants Gufler 7 3 4
11 Шаблон:FIN Jussi Uusipaavalniemi 8 4 4
12 Шаблон:ENG Eric Laidler 7 2 5
13 Шаблон:BEL Marcel Marién 6 1 5
14 Шаблон:NED Otto Veening 6 0 6

Final standings

The final rankings were as follows.[2]

Place Country Skip Games Wins Losses
Шаблон:Gold1 Шаблон:FRG Andrea Schöpp 7 7 0
Шаблон:Silver2 Шаблон:SUI Marianne Flotron 8 5 3
Шаблон:Bronze3 Шаблон:SWE Anette Norberg 6 5 1
4 Шаблон:DEN Helena Blach 10 5 5
5 Шаблон:NOR Trine Trulsen 9 5 4
6 Шаблон:SCO Kirsty Addison 7 3 4
7 Шаблон:FRA Paulette Sulpice 7 3 4
8 Шаблон:ITA Ann Lacedelli 6 2 4
9 Шаблон:FIN Jaana Jokela 7 4 3
10 Шаблон:WAL Helen Lyon 6 2 4
11 Шаблон:NED Jenny Bovenschen 6 2 4
12 Шаблон:AUT Lilly Hummelt 7 2 5
13 Шаблон:ENG Caroline Cumming 6 1 5
